Michael Myers, Oogie Boogie, Krampus, and Universal Monsters Join Mattel's Upcoming Monster High Lineup
The world of toys meets the thrill of classic horror as Mattel's latest announcement brings beloved characters from horror cinema to its Monster High lineup. Just in time for the San Diego Comic-Con, the new additions include iconic figures such as Michael Myers, Oogie Boogie, and Krampus, alongside the timeless Universal Monsters. This exciting crossover is not only a treat for collectors but also a nod to the enduring popularity of these iconic horror personalities.
Quick Summary
Mattel is set to launch a new series of Monster High Skullector dolls that feature horror icons from various franchises. The collection includes characters like Michael Myers from "Halloween II," Oogie Boogie from "The Nightmare Before Christmas," Krampus, and variations of classic Universal Monsters.

Main Characters or Key People
Although Mattel’s lineup features well-known horror icons, notable mentions include:
- Michael Myers: The infamous masked killer from the "Halloween" franchise, representing enduring slasher horror.
- Oogie Boogie: The quirky villain from "The Nightmare Before Christmas," who brings a playful yet mischievous energy to the collection.
- Krampus: The sinister counterpart to Santa Claus, Krampus adds a supernatural twist to the holiday spirit.
- Universal Monsters: Characters like Frankenstein’s Monster highlight the legacy of horror that has influenced pop culture for decades.
